Chapter 2

The Wolf and The Hunter

Jisung was one of very few people who was content with being alone. In a team of 10 people he took whatever time he had at home alone to relish in it. It was too bad that Hohyeon and Kangmin were coming home tonight, returning from university for the summer. He didn't mind them, they were more mature for their age than most humans he had run into, but he was starting to enjoy the solitude, occasionally checking in on the pack next door for food if he ran out and was too lazy to go grocery shopping.

Their house was large for 1 person, and even 10 people had 2 people to a room. He had shared his room with Hyunwoo, and he still did even if Hyunwoo wasn't around as often, being part of the team taking the international missions in Asia with Wooyeop.

He was in the middle of making dinner for himself, Kangmin and Hohyeon when Kangmin and Hohyeon finally arrived. "Hey you two," he called. "Dinner should be ready soon," he called. "Thanks hyung!" Said Kangmin and Hohyeon as they headed up to their room. "Those two," Jisung said with a chuckle as he went back to making dinner.

He was done and about to call out to Hohyeon and Kangmin when they both came downstairs ready to eat dinner. Jisung gave them their plates and they sat around the kitchen island to eat.

"How's being home alone for parts of the year going?" Asked Hohyeon. "Fine," said Jisung. "You know I prefer to be alone," he said, shrugging. "Yeah," said Kangmin. "How's school going for you both?" Asked Jisung. "Fine," said Kangmin. Hohyeon nodded in agreement. "It's been stressful but we're in a lot of the same classes so," he said, shrugging. "Nice, nice," said Jisung.

"I know Taeseon and them should be returning from Europe soon," said Hohyeon. "They made quick work of the rest of the vampires that were causing trouble in Europe," he said. "Well, that's good I guess," said Jisung. "It'll afford for the others to finally get home at least," he said. "Hyunwoo has been complaining about not being able to get home because they don't have the cash," he said. "They're in Laos right now, enjoying some time with Nickhun and his pack," he said.

"I know they want to ask for help getting home but," Kangmin said, scratching the back of his head. "At least Siwoo and Hakmin are still here in the states," he said. "They should be returning home soon anyway," he said.

"Well, I'm going for a walk," said Jisung as he finished eating dinner. "I'll be back in an hour or so, I want to pay my respects at the graveyard," he said. "Don't be out too late," said Hohyeon. "No worries," said Jisung as he went to put on some shoes and head out.

He made his way down to the lake, grabbing flowers along the way. The first thing he did was go pay his respects before going to lean against the giant boulder next to the lake, enjoying the silence of the night.

After an hour he heard the distinct sound of paw steps coming towards the lake and he froze, turning slightly and spying a wolf coming up to where he was. He was silent, watching as the wolf went to drop flowers at the graves before it went to stand by the water on the other side of the boulder.

After a few minutes Jisung made his presence known, moving from his spot and going to stand beside the wolf. "Nice night hm?" He asked. The wolf turned its head and looked at Jisung before nodding and turning back to look up at the moon. Jisung hummed to himself as he picked up a rock and skipped it across the water.

"You're like me, you prefer to be alone than in the company of others," he said. The wolf snorts and nudged him. Jisung laughs. "I'll take that as you agreeing with me," he said. "You must be with the pack that lives next door," he said, earning another bump from the wolf beside him. They enjoyed each other's company, Jisung eventually sitting down beside the wolf and leaning back on his hands as he looked up at the stars.

The silence was interrupted by Hohyeon and Jungkook calling for Jisung and Kihyun respectively. "Oh, you're that wolf," said Jisung as he turned to Kihyun. Kihyun nodded and stood, stretching. Jisung got up, stretching as he called to Hohyeon and Jungkook. "Over here," he called.

"It's almost midnight, Jesus guys," said Hohyeon as he and Jungkook came into view. Jisung looked at his pocketwatch, blinking in surprise. "How long were we out here for?" He asked. "6 hours," said Jungkook. "Time flies so fast," said Jisung.

"You're okay right? Kihyun didn't do anything?" Asked Hohyeon. "No, we just sat and enjoyed each other's company," said Jisung as he scratched the back of his head. "Oh, that's new," said Jungkook. "Well, we should get going then," said Hohyeon. "Kangmin was about to come searching for you," he said. Jisung sighed. "Alright," he said. "I'll see you guys around then," he said before leaving with Hohyeon.

"Hyung!" Said Kangmin as Hohyeon entered the house with Jisung. "Before staying outside for like 5 hours at least bring your phone," he said. Jisung scratched the back of his head. "Sorry, I wasn't aware of being out there for that long," he said. "Go and take a shower and get to bed," said Hohyeon. "I wonder what you do when we're not here," he said, shaking his head. Jisung scratched the back of his head in embarrassment and went to take a shower.

After he was done he came back downstairs, spotting Hohyeon and Kangmin sitting on the couch watching a movie. "Come join us," said Hohyeon. "Sure," said Jisung as he went to sit on the recliner. "What are we watching?" He asked. "The Conjuring," said Kangmin. "Scary movies? Always fun to watch before bed," said Jisung.
